## FAQ: Why is the waveform preview blank?

The Soundgrove preview renderer falls back to a blank strip when peak extraction times out, usually on files over twenty minutes or with corrupt headers. Check the extractor worker's dead-letter count first; if it's climbing, restart the pool before re-queueing. Individual files can be reprocessed manually. The full diagnostic checklist, including header-repair steps, is maintained on this page.

dashboard of bafof-hafog = https://confluence.lumiclabs.internal/display/browse/display/6a09a20a

Subject: Key rotation for InvoiceForge renderer

Welcome, new folks. Every quarter we rotate the credential the Pellworth PDF invoice renderer uses to call our internal asset service, Vaultline. The old key stops working Friday at noon. Update your local .env and the staging config before then, and verify a test invoice renders with the new embedded fonts. For convenience, the freshly issued key is included here.

app token of bagef-bageg = kto11_vuwA0uhrEMg

Handover: thumbnail queue (Snapjaw). Workers pull from the `thumbs` topic, write to the media bucket, three retries then dead-letter. Known issue: oversized PNGs stall workers — restart the pod, don't requeue. Scaling is manual for now; config in `snapjaw-deploy`. Dashboards under Media/Thumbs. Monitor dead-letter depth daily. Any questions or access requests go to the maintainer named below.

named custodian: Brivan Eliath Quenox Frador